Conservation of Energy Sample Problems
1. An electrical motor lifts a 575 N box 20 meters straight up by a rope with constant velocity for 10.0 s. What power is developed by the motor?
2. Starting from rest, a child zooms down a frictionless slide from an initial height of 3.0 m. What is her speed at the bottom of the slide? Assume she has a mass of 25.0 kg.
3. An amusement park roller coaster car has a mass of 250 kg. During the ride, it is towed to the top of a 30 m hill, where it is released from rest and allowed to roll. The car plunges down the hill, then up a 10 m hill and through a loop with a radius of 10 m. Assume that the tracks are frictionless.
a. What is the Potential Energy of the car at the top of the 30 m hill?
b. What is the Kinetic Energy and the speed of the car at the bottom of the 30 m hill?
c. What is the Kinetic Energy and the speed of the car at the top of the 10 m hill?
